    The Life of Marco Polo

  • Mission Inspiring Marco
    Jan 1, 1260

    Mission Inspiring Marco

    Nicola and Mateo Polo (Marco's uncle and father) head to Constantinople on a trade mission, and this mission was to inspire Marco to go with them later.
  • Kublai Khan Mission
    Jan 1, 1266

    Kublai Khan Mission

    Kublai Khan sent the Polos to the Pope requesting 100 Missionaries to teach. The letter authorized the Polos to get food and lodging.
  • While Marco Travels
    Oct 7, 1271

    While Marco Travels

    After giving the letter to the Pope, Marco Polo set out with his dad and Uncle. They had 2 missionaries and were also carrying letters.
  • Marco With Kublai
    Oct 2, 1274

    Marco With Kublai

    The Polos spend 17 years in China. Kublai takes a liking to Marco, and sends him on missions. Marco was the governer of the city of Yangzhou for 3 years.
  • Death of Kublai Khan
    Mar 16, 1294

    Death of Kublai Khan

    The Polos rested in Persia for 2 years and they were about to go to China when they heard that Kublai Khan died, so they headed to go to Venice with lots of loot.
  • People Not Believing
    Jan 2, 1295

    People Not Believing

    The Polos return to Venice and with them riches and stories the Polos told the people, but the people did not believe them.
  • Marco Polo During War
    Oct 5, 1298

    Marco Polo During War

    Marco Polo was made a 'Man Commander" of a galley. His ship joins a battle and is taken away as prisoner. Marco meets a writer and tells him about his travels in eastern Asia in jail.
  • Marco Free
    Dec 14, 1299

    Marco Free

    Marco is released as prisoner of war in Genoa.
  • Famous Book
    Jan 1, 1307

    Famous Book

    A copy of a book of Marco's travels becomes famous.
  • Marco Dies
    Jan 8, 1324

    Marco Dies

    Marco dies in Venice, Italy, 1324.
